Ticket: Migration vault locked mid-deploy. Context: zero-downtime schema migration on Ostrel, expand phase done, contract phase blocked because the Bellhook vault sealed after a node restart. Dual-writes still active, so no data risk. Action for new folks: do not retry the migration. Unseal the vault first, verify replicas agree, then resume. Unsealing needs one operator plus the recovery passphrase recorded below.

unlock words, yawig-kagef: gordor-holvan-ulaael-pramir-ulaiel-tamdor

Minutes — Management Meeting, Tolvey & Marsh

Attendees: leadership plus sales leads. Quick session. Dena walked us through the possible acquisition of Brightquill Systems — their pipeline tooling would plug neatly into our Fieldmark suite. Diligence starts next month; keep this off client calls for now. Full context for sales leads is in the confidential note below.

management briefing: Project Ulavan slips by two quarters because of the staffing delay.

Subject: Incremental rebuilds — handover

Hey,

Quick handoff before I'm out. The Brackenfold incremental rebuild path is merged; only changed pages re-render now, full builds are the fallback. Watch the diff-hash logic in review — it's the fragile bit. Deploys push through the usual channel and are verified with this key.

deploy key for kajof-fajop: bky6_gDHw9Q

Facilities Ticket — Cleaning Crew Access, Brindle Annex

For new starters handling evening lock-up: the Sorano Cleaning crew arrives nightly at 21:30 via the annex side door. Check their rota sheet, note arrival in the log, and ensure the storeroom is relocked afterward. To let them through the side door, enter the access code below.

badge for yaweg-hafog: bdg-GX-6

**Release checklist — ParcelPing webhook cutover.** Before we flip the switch, double-check that the retry queue for the ParcelPing delivery-status webhook drains cleanly in staging. Last cycle, stale events piled up and the Dovetail dashboard showed parcels stuck in "in transit" for hours. Confirm the signature validation toggle is ON, then smoke-test with three synthetic shipments. Once that's green, paste the build token below so we can trace the exact artifact.

session token of yajof-bagef = htk4_937d